Wow what can I say, we booked a table for 5.15 and arrive around 15 minutes early. We were seated straight away. Water was on the table when we arrived, we ordered our drinks and then the food. We had some small plates to share for a starter, then we had pork belly and a fig and rocket salad. The food was amazing and so was the staff. Nothing was too much trouble and they were very friendly. We sat on a huge table (there was 3 of us) and it does state on the website that during busy periods, tables may need to shared. We did not have the tour, but bought some beers at the bar before we left. can't wait to return. Price did include service charge, which we were happy to pay for as the service was fab! 😊

Brilliant tour (£20 per person) and tasting - thank you to Ben who was really informative, knowledgeable and truly enthusiastic about the products! Followed by a prebooked - we booked online - fantastic lunch. Menu is perfect, a mixture of small plates and main meals. I had homemade Sausages and Mash - they were stunning and my husband had the beef burger which he also loved. Great service, helpful, cheerful people and great value - thank you very much, we will be back and have recommended you to everyone!

Seen this brewery several times when visiting Ashford Outlet. Having had many other good experiences with brewery taprooms (Westerham, Titsey and Dorking (Gin Kitchen)) decided to visit as we were in the area. It’s easy to book a table. Car parking was plentiful. Service was good and the waitresses were friendly and pleasant. There is a lot of seating at high and low tables. Menu has small plates and mains. Had a chicken burger - probably the best I’ve ever had and a couple of drinks - the cider was pleasant enough, but the Millionaire’s stout was the best stout I’ve ever had. Recommend a visit.
